Turkey to procure "clever" deadly strike fighter
The F-35 Joint Strike Fighter (JSF), also called the Lighting II, a new strike fighter which is being procured in different versions for the Air Force, Marine Corps, and Navy by consortium of nine countries, will replenish the air fleet of Turkey and some NATO-states in place of currently existing combat planes, Islamnews.ru agency reported.
Turkey, which was among countries that contributed varying amounts of research and development funding to the program, is planning to replace its F-16.
The Joint Strike Fighter Program budget requested $11 billion. The F-35 Lighting II is a single-seat aircraft with supersonic dash capability. The F-35 program develops and deploys a family of highly capable, affordable, fifth generation strike fighter aircraft to meet the operational needs of the Air Force, Navy, Marine Corps, and Allies with optimum commonality to minimize life cycle costs. The F-35 was designed from the bottom-up to be our premier surface-to-air missile killer and is uniquely equipped for this mission with cutting edge processing power, synthetic aperture radar integration techniques, and advanced target recognition.
Turkish media say that the new strike fighter is “a clever killer.”
